Young people are fighting back across the country against Christian Nationalism and for a more inclusive future, and we want to recognize their important work.
Nominate a youth leader for the 2026 David Norr Youth Activist Award by January 26, 2026. The winner will receive $1,000 and be recognized at the 2026 Summit for Religious Freedom.
Named in honor of the late David Norr, a staunch advocate and supporter of Americans United for over 25 years, this award goes to an individual or group who goes above and beyond to advocate for the separation of church and state.
The winner of the David Norr Youth Activist Award will receive a paid trip to attend the Summit for Religious Freedom (SRF) in the Washington, D.C., area next spring, where they will receive their award live on stage.
Nominees could be grassroots activists, student leaders, plaintiffs, elected officials, storytellers or another young person (or group of young people) who have demonstrated leadership and courage in taking action to protect and advance church-state separation in their community.
Our most recent award recipient was Tatiana Chance, who co-leads the Pasque Project, a community-based initiative in South Dakota focused on understanding the needs of people facing barriers to access reproductive health care, including youth (especially Native youth), immigrants and those in rural communities. She led a multi-year project in collaboration with South Dakota Faith in Public Life to document congregations’ beliefs on reproductive and religious freedom; educate communities about Christian Nationalism; and challenge religion-based abortion stigma through art and activism.
